1456 Elgin Avenue W – Property Summary

Key Characteristics & Buyer Profile

This is a modest, older home in Winnipeg’s Weston neighbourhood, built in 1925 on a 3,463 sqft lot. The living area is 811 sqft—smaller than the street and city averages, but closer to the neighbourhood norm. Its assessed value of $157,000 is well below the citywide median, reflecting both the home’s size and age.

The appeal lies in affordability and land. The lot is slightly above average for the neighbourhood and ranks in the top 36% on the street—uncommon for a house this size. That gives a buyer room for a garage, garden, or future expansion without paying for a larger house they don’t need. The year built (1925) places it among older homes in Weston, which may appeal to someone who values character or a more established street over modern finishes.

This property suits first-time buyers with a tight budget, investors looking for a low-cost entry in a stable area, or handy buyers comfortable with updating an older home. It’s less suited for anyone needing turnkey space or a prime citywide location, as the living area and value rank low citywide. The Weston neighbourhood itself is mixed, with older stock and average values—practical for those who prioritize square footage of land over square footage of house.
